Le Sun Pharmaceuticals is a biopharmaceutical company based in Changzhou, China, that focuses on the discovery and development of next-generation small molecule anti-cancer therapeutics. Founded in 2011 and operating as a key innovation subsidiary of Changzhou Qianhong Biopharma, the company specializes in targeting cell cycle regulators such as cyclin-dependent kinases (CDKs). Its lead clinical asset, Sunaciclib (QHRD107), is a potent CDK9 inhibitor currently in Phase 2 clinical trials for acute myelocytic leukemia and solid tumors. Beyond its internal drug pipeline, Le Sun Pharmaceuticals provides a wide range of CDMO and CRO services, including API process development, formulation research, and analytical testing support. The company maintains significant academic and industry partnerships, including a joint laboratory with the University of South Australia and a strategic collaboration with Yabao Pharmaceutical Group.
